A web development process consists of well-thought-out processes which produce outstanding results. As a top-rated web application development company, we follow the right web application development process, which is critical to the success of any project, regardless of size.
To design a highly functional digital solution, follow all seven web development procedures outlined below. Let's take a closer look at each stage of web application development.
STEP 1: Ideation and Requirement Review.
Creating a solid concept is the first stage in any successful product development process, including web apps. The concept should address the issues that potential clients are facing.
The first stage is ideation, which involves conducting research, outlining needs, and improving your idea. All of these will help you acquire critical information that you can use to create an exceptional product with a unique selling point.
STEP 2: Plan and Strategy
After a greater understanding of the project, the following phase is to plan and strategise how to proceed. Before beginning technical development, a web app development services provider designs out how the web apps will look and function. Businesses can avoid several delays in the latter stages by specifying the basic architecture and layout for customised web application development.
Developers build a blueprint using flowcharts and sketches to determine the overall architecture of the web application based on the information gathered throughout the previous stages of the web app development process.
By showing the connections between different web pages, sitemaps and flowcharts both help you comprehend how your website's internal structure will be set up and operate. Wireframes are commonly used to provide a visual representation of the user interface. To guarantee that the application's core is created accurately, the top web app development firms keep clients informed during this stage.
Once the general framework has been determined, businesses should develop a prototype to gain a better understanding of how the final app will work. Additionally, companies will be able to spot and fix issues early on thanks to this early prototype.
Step 3: Creating a Web App
Once the site architecture and wireframes are finished, the designers proceed to the visual elements. Using the wireframe from the previous step, buttons, tabs, menus, dashboards, colour schemes, typography, and graphics are developed to establish the fundamental framework of the website.
The layout design stage of web application development is when UI-UX designers are most visible. Making a brief sketch, which may be graphical, is necessary for the layout in order to get a feel for the style of the website. The layout's goal is to provide an informative framework that allows your clients to see the essential features and material.
When developing its designs, a web application development services company takes the target audience into account. They talk with clients on the style of the website (colours, logos, images, etc.) and tailor it to the preferences of the target audience.
STEP 4: Development of Web Apps
During the development phase, the application is built. The website's client-side and server-side development is finished at this point. In the process of developing a website, it consumes the most time.
The development of the codes to carry out the designs and establish the business logic takes place at this point. The front-end and back-end development are divided into two phases by the web app development business, which may or may not be completed simultaneously.
- Development of Front-End Websites 
Front-end development is the term for development that occurs on the "client-side." Users view and interact with the front end on the browser. In this case, user participation is crucial. The wireframing design is converted into interactive web page elements by the front-end development business.
- Development of Back-end Web Pages 
Users are unable to see this portion of the online application. The back end exchanges data with the front end so that users can engage with the features of the website.
The implementation of all business logic and data storage is closely watched by the back-end software developers. Database design and integration, API creation and integration, security audits, and other tasks are all included in back-end development.
STEP 5: Quality Assurance
Testing is a necessary step in the web application development process to ensure that your software is error-free. Testing guarantees that the application will work as intended after it is made available. The functionality, usability, and overall performance of the online application should usually be checked.
To identify and address any issues, a web application development company tests the application extensively once it is created. The web application's performance, usability, compatibility, and functionality are all extensively tested by the QA team utilising techniques such as load testing, integration testing, stress testing, and unit testing.
STEP 6: Deployment
Your web application development process is prepared for launch as soon as it has passed all required testing and received the quality team's approval. Some of the platforms that eLuminous Technologies uses to deliver web apps to servers.
Application deployment is the process of installing, setting up, updating, and enabling a single program or collection of programs that enable a software system to function, such as enabling a particular URL on a server.
After finishing the last testing and being found to be bug-free, businesses can start releasing their web apps to the public and commencing marketing campaigns to attract new users. Additionally, they can improve the web application's online visibility and searchability.
Final Call
Globally, there are almost 2 billion online applications. Your program will fail to capture consumers' hearts if it lacks originality. Customised solutions that target a specific user base increase the likelihood of turning leads into customers, but also reduce the application's reach.
It's a prevalent misconception that the creation of web applications is solely about code. However, it's not! There are numerous phases involved in developing a web application. All seven phases of the web app development cycle should be well-defined in this guide.
 
		
 
		 
	 
	 
	 
	